目录导读
- 欧易撮合引擎的核心挑战
- FPGA技术如何实现微秒级延迟
- 欧易撮合引擎架构的独特设计
- FPGA与传统CPU的性能对比
- 常见问题解答
欧易撮合引擎的核心挑战
在数字货币交易领域,撮合引擎的性能直接决定用户体验和市场效率,欧易交易所官网作为全球领先的数字资产交易平台,其撮合引擎面临着每秒数万笔订单的极端压力,传统基于CPU的软件撮合架构在瓶颈期难以满足毫秒级甚至微秒级的需求。

欧易撮合引擎团队通过引入FPGA技术,实现了交易延迟从毫秒级到微秒级的跨越,这一革命性突破不仅提升了订单处理速度,更显著增强了系统在高频交易场景下的稳定性。
FPGA技术如何实现微秒级延迟
FPGA(现场可编程门阵列)是一种可重构的硬件芯片,其独特优势在于能够通过硬件电路直接执行计算任务,欧易撮合引擎采用FPGA后,订单从接收到匹配完成的全流程延迟降至亚微秒级别,相比传统CPU方案降低了约100倍。
其核心技术原理包括:
- 硬件流水线并行处理:FPGA可将多个交易对的处理逻辑固化在芯片内部,实现真正的并行运算
- 自定义数据路径:去除操作系统和中间件开销,直接通过硬件逻辑完成订单簿更新
- 低抖动通信:通过直连网卡和内存控制器,减少数据传输延迟
问答环节:为什么FPGA比CPU更适合撮合场景?
答:CPU擅长复杂多任务切换,但存在上下文切换和缓存未命中等问题;FPGA以固定逻辑电路运行,无操作系统干扰,在固定算法场景下延迟更低、吞吐量更高。
欧易撮合引擎架构的独特设计
欧易交易所官网的撮合引擎由三层核心组件构成:
1 订单接收层
采用FPGA实现协议解析与校验,每秒可处理超过100万笔订单,通过硬件级过滤,无效订单在纳秒级别被拒绝。
2 价格匹配层
由多块FPGA组成价格优先-时间优先的硬件匹配逻辑,订单簿维护在FPGA内部BRAM中,实现纳秒级访问,这一层还支持市价单与限价单的混合快速处理。
3 成交反馈层
匹配结果通过低延迟总线直接写入共享内存,再由软件模块生成交易记录,整个过程延迟稳定在0.5微秒以内。
FPGA与传统CPU的性能对比
| 项目 | 传统CPU架构 | 欧易FPGA架构 |
|---|---|---|
| 单笔订单延迟 | 50-500微秒 | 5-2微秒 |
| 每秒吞吐量 | 1万-5万笔 | 10万-50万笔 |
| 延迟确定性 | 较差(受OS干扰) | 极佳(硬件固定路径) |
| 功耗表现 | 较高 | 更低 |
| 二次开发难度 | 低 | 较高(需硬件编程) |
这一对比清晰展现了FPGA在低延迟、高吞吐场景下的绝对优势,欧易交易所下载后用户可体验到的快速成交,正是基于此技术。
常见问题解答
Q:FPGA架构是否会影响交易公平性?
A: 不会,欧易撮合引擎的FPGA逻辑严格遵循价格优先、时间优先原则,所有订单在硬件层面获得同等处理,微秒级延迟确保先到先得,反而提升了公平性。
Q:普通用户能否直接感受到FPGA带来的优势?
A: 可以,当大量用户同时下单时,FPGA架构能避免订单堆积和成交延迟,用户通过 欧易交易所 官网进行[欧易交易所下载]和交易,会明显感受到交易速度提升。
Q:FPGA技术未来还会如何升级?
A: 欧易团队持续向PCIe Gen4/Gen5接口迁移,并探索将AI预测模块集成至FPGA,实现智能订单路由。
欧易撮合引擎的FPGA技术变革,为数字资产交易平台树立了微秒级延迟的新标杆,通过硬件重构交易链路,欧易交易所官网不仅提升了自身竞争力,更推动了行业技术标准的演进,对于追求极致交易体验的用户而言,选择欧易交易所官网进行[欧易交易所下载]和使用,将获得更快速、更稳定的交易服务。
如需深入了解,可访问 欧易交易所 官网查看技术白皮书。
标签: 撮合引擎